When local insurgents attempt a coup d’etat, the nation’s President takes refuge inside the embassy. The embassy is then besieged by the well-armed insurgents. The U.S. Ambassador is killed in the ensuing action, and it’s now up to Jean-Claude and the embassy’s small detachment of U.S. Marines to fend off the attackers..
Plot: Armed insurgents attempt a coup d’etat in a troubled Eastern European country, and the president flees to the U.S. embassy for protection. When the U.S. ambassador is murdered by the ruthless and gun-happy rebels, it comes down to the second-in-command of the embassy, Sam Keenan, played by Belgian kickboxer Jean-Claude Van Damme, to use his amazing martial arts technique to defend the besieged.

Never doubt Van Damme, that’s an order.
In the Eastern European nation of Moldavia, the new appointed prime minister is facing some political resistance, where some figures want to take him down. To do so, they plan a sniper to shoot an innocent civilian, which makes it look like the prime minister’s guards were shooting. Riots break out and it’s up to American marine Sam Keenan to get the prime minister to the American Embassy for protection. Soon they find out there’s a large militia group outside the Embassy and they want the prime minister. So the small group of American soldiers and civilians hold up inside and try to wait for reinforcements, while the well-armed insurgents surround the building.

Jean Claude Van Damme has kind of been in the wilderness of churning out straight to DVD junk over the last decade, but honestly on this occasion what entertaining junk “Second in Command” turned out to be. As Van Damme action vehicles go, “Second in Command” is a modest action thriller joint that delivers the goods in a fast-paced and intense fashion, even though the whole one-idea set-up is familiarly derived. It does comes off, though. “The Alamo” reference is fitting to what you’re seeing and it also takes some tips from Ridley Scott’s frenetic “Black Hawk Down”. The premise starts off at a breakneck pace and then tightly builds up to its chaotic siege situation with a exhilarating climax with some organic grit. Along the way it offers up a surprise or two and there’s no real political interference in how they shape the story, despite the topic at hand and flawed nature. Logic is lacking and it’s far from clever. The basic script won’t set the film alight, but never falls into any cheesy mumbling. It’s an old school layout with new technology adding to the glitz. The camera-work has that natural doco-style intrusion with many nauseating movements, fast editing is razor sharp, slow-motion gets a look in and the musical score has a cutting techno jibe that stays in the background. I usually can’t stand these types of novel techniques, but it was easy to swallow because it never gets overwhelmed by it all.

The action scenes, which for this type of film is what we are actually hanging around for. Are handled with great vigour and the set-pieces can raise a sweat. Those looking for Van Damme’s crisply striking martial arts skills will get very little of it, even though it boasts a few exciting one-one combat scenes (mainly the climax with the lead bad guy), but instead there are ample explosions and raining gunfire that makes sure this parade is aggressively violent. There’s plenty of bang for your buck! The robust direction by Simon Fellows can build up the tension effectively and it does well to staying to its strengths, as it feels larger than it actually is, because it works around its budget restraints to achieve an honest attempt. The film location was in Romania, but you can easily tell when they were staged on sets and the real stock footage interwoven into the film sticks out clearly. They do get that washed out look with a dusty and at times hazy air forming in certain sequences. Jean Claude Van Damme is capably good and fit’s the mould perfectly, with his downtrodden and workman like performance of a more beatable and humane character than anything overly heroic. Yeah he ain’t bad at all. The rest of the support performances are agreeable enough.

“Second in Command” is a bold, noisy, ultra-zippy action film, which doesn’t kick up anything of special importance or originality, but to simply entertain. It enjoyably succeeds and never lets a flat note get hold.
